What Are Non-Destructive Testing Methods for Alloy Plate Integrity? .
Non-destructive screening techniques for alloy plate integrity are inspection methods utilized to examine the buildings of an alloy plate without triggering damage. Unlike destructive examinations that call for cutting or breaking samples, these approaches maintain the material undamaged. Typical techniques include ultrasonic testing, radiographic testing, magnetic particle examination, liquid penetrant screening, and eddy present screening. Each technique discloses surprise defects like fractures, spaces, additions, or corrosion that could compromise efficiency. The objective is simple: find troubles early so they do not develop into failings later on.

Exactly How Do Non-Destructive Testing Techniques for Alloy Plate Integrity Work? .
Each non-destructive testing approach for alloy plate honesty works differently. Ultrasonic testing sends high-frequency sound waves right into the plate. If there is an imperfection, the waves recover in such a way that reveals its dimension and location. Radiographic testing uses X-rays or gamma rays to create images of home plate’s interior, much like a clinical X-ray. Magnetic bit evaluation works on ferromagnetic alloys– when allured, surface area splits attract iron bits, making problems noticeable. Fluid penetrant screening includes finish home plate with a tinted dye that leaks into surface openings; after cleaning, a designer makes the color reappear where flaws exist. Swirl present testing uses electro-magnetic induction to find surface area and near-surface issues in conductive materials. Skilled technicians pick the right technique based upon the alloy kind, anticipated problems, and required sensitivity.
Applications of Non-Destructive Screening Methods for Alloy Plate Stability .
These screening methods are used any place alloy plates carry heavy lots or face severe conditions. In l'aerospaziale, they evaluate wing skins and body panels made from light weight aluminum or titanium alloys. In a centrale nucleare, they examine pressure vessels and steam pipelines for covert damage. Automotive makers use them to confirm chassis elements and battery rooms in electrical cars. Shipbuilding depends on them for hull plates subjected to deep sea corrosion. Even in renewable energy, wind generator towers and solar installing structures undergo normal checks. As lightweight alloys gain grip in electrical automobile layout, guaranteeing their structural sturdiness comes to be even more critical. FAQs About Non-Destructive Screening Approaches for Alloy Plate Stability .
Can non-destructive testing locate all types of problems?
Micca sempre. Some approaches just find surface area splits, while others discover interior problems. Di solitu, examiners incorporate two or more techniques for complete coverage.
Is it expensive?
First setup prices can be high, but gradually, it saves cash by preventing failings, decreasing waste, and expanding life span.
Do I require special training?
Iè. Translating results correctly needs qualified personnel who comprehend both the devices and the material behavior.
How usually should testing be done?
It depends upon use, atmosphere, and industry criteria. Crucial elements might be tested throughout manufacturing, after installment, and at regular periods during solution.
Can these approaches work on repainted or covered plates?
In certi casi. Thick coatings might interfere, especially with ultrasonic or eddy existing testing. In such situations, small areas may need cleaning prior to evaluation.
